Prep Time: 10 mins
Total Time: 30 mins
Servings: 24 servings (1/2 cup each)

Ingredients

  • 8  cups  popped microwave popcorn (from 3-oz bag)On Sale
  • 5  cups  Cheerios® cerealOn Sale
  • 1  cup  honey-roasted peanutsOn Sale
  • 1  cup  raisinsOn Sale
  • 1/2  cup  light corn syrupOn Sale
  • 1/3  cup  honeyOn Sale
  • 2  tablespoons  butter or margarineOn Sale
  • 1/4  teaspoon  ground cinnamonOn Sale
  • 1/2  teaspoon  vanillaOn Sale

Directions
1.
Heat oven to 350 degrees F. Remove and discard unpopped kernels from popped popcorn. In large bowl, mix popcorn, cereal, peanuts and raisins; set aside.
2.
In 1-quart saucepan, heat corn syrup, honey, butter and cinnamon to boiling. Remove from heat; stir in vanilla. Pour over cereal mixture; toss until evenly coated. Spread in ungreased 15x10x1-inch pan.
3.
Bake 15 minutes, stirring occasionally. Cool pan on cooling rack, stirring occasionally. Store loosely covered.

Tip
High Altitude (3500-6500 ft): Heat oven to 375 degrees F.
